- Opana is a prescription drug which is a semi-synthetic opioid pain killer closely related to morphine.
- Magic mushrooms are ingested orally (swallowed or chewed) or brewed as a tea or added to other foods to mask their bitter flavor.
- Methadone withdrawal can be up to twice as severe as morphine or heroin withdrawal and can last for several weeks or more.
- Long-term heavy drinking can accelerate the development of age-related postural instability, increasing the likelihood of falls.
Galway - Persons with HIV/AIDSDrug addiction will take its toll on even the healthiest individuals. When people in Galway with HIV/AIDS abuse drugs and alcohol it can take a deadly toll on them. Since they suffer with a reduced immune system, a thing as simple as the typical cold can become a hazardous sickness. They expose themselves to other deadly infections too: Hepatitis C, pneumonia and tuberculosis just to list a few. Entering a drug treatment program that specializes in treating persons with HIV/AIDS is necessary. The addicted person will be ready to restore their sobriety and boost their quality of life exceptionally. Science today has been able to produce many medications that not only help persons with HIV/AIDS but make their life healthier and longer.
